Home
last modified time | relevance | path

Searched refs:PL_regkind (Results 1 – 3 of 3) sorted by relevance

/mirbsd/src/gnu/usr.bin/perl/
Dregnodes.h71 EXTCONST U8 PL_regkind[]; variable
73 EXTCONST U8 PL_regkind[] = { variable
Dregcomp.c689 if (PL_regkind[(U8)OP(scan)] == EXACT) { in S_study_chunk()
700 ( PL_regkind[(U8)OP(n)] == NOTHING || in S_study_chunk()
706 if (PL_regkind[(U8)OP(n)] == NOTHING) { in S_study_chunk()
780 if (PL_regkind[(U8)OP(n)] != NOTHING || OP(n) == NOTHING) { in S_study_chunk()
801 && ((PL_regkind[(U8)OP(n)] == NOTHING && (noff = NEXT_OFF(n))) in S_study_chunk()
973 else if (PL_regkind[(U8)OP(scan)] == EXACT) { /* But OP != EXACT! */ in S_study_chunk()
1027 switch (PL_regkind[(U8)OP(scan)]) { in S_study_chunk()
1165 && !(PL_regkind[(U8)OP(nxt)] == EXACT in S_study_chunk()
1352 while (PL_regkind[(U8)OP(next = regnext(oscan))] == NOTHING in S_study_chunk()
1382 switch (PL_regkind[(U8)OP(scan)]) { in S_study_chunk()
[all …]
Dregexec.c154 (PL_regkind[(U8)OP(rn)] == CURLY && ARG1(rn) > 0) \
158 PL_regkind[(U8)OP(rn)] == EXACT || PL_regkind[(U8)OP(rn)] == REF \
167 if (OP(rn) == SUSPEND || PL_regkind[(U8)OP(rn)] == CURLY) \
863 const int cl_l = (PL_regkind[(U8)OP(prog->regstclass)] == EXACT in Perl_re_intuit_start()
1938 if (PL_regkind[op] != EXACT && op != CANY) in Perl_regexec_flags()
3442 if (PL_regkind[(U8)OP(text_node)] == REF) { in S_regmatch()
3505 if (PL_regkind[(U8)OP(text_node)] == REF) { in S_regmatch()
3603 if (PL_regkind[(U8)OP(text_node)] == REF) { in S_regmatch()
3770 if (ln < n && PL_regkind[(U8)OP(next)] == EOL && in S_regmatch()